          #5
          Are you asking for paint brands? If so, any of the name brand paints are all great. Like RM Diamont, DuPont, PPG, and others. Don't use a single stage paint, go with a good two stage (base/clear).

          Comment


            #6
            like trav said go with a 2 stage and wet sand and be meticulous with sanding/preping that will make the outcome and longevity 1000x better
